The Carlyle Group Inc. 4.625% Subordinated Notes due 2061

NONE · NONE · USA

The Carlyle Group Inc. 4.625% Subordinated Notes due 2061 are issued by a preeminent global investment firm renowned for its diverse portfolio management across private equity, credit, and real assets. These subordinated notes present a compelling yield opportunity for income-focused institutional investors, leveraging Carlyle's deep market insights and historical performance. As the firm continues to strategically broaden its international footprint, these notes serve as a valuable instrument for investors aiming to integrate fixed-income solutions with Carlyle's long-term growth strategies and resilient capital allocation framework.
